Abstract

The North Sumatra Basin is one of the Tertiary back-arc basins which has been explored since the colonial era. The existence of overpressured zone has already been recognized. This is due to the existence of shale or claystone sequence that is capable to generate overpressure condition. Therefore, the understanding and knowledge of pore pressure and the mud weight used to counter the pressure are of paramount importance. The approach used to define pore pressure value with Eaton empirical method is generally done on wells only. In this research, determination of lateral pore pressure distribution is done with the seismic image and seismic interval velocity data. Wireline log and seismic interval velocity data are both being integrated to generate the pore pressure estimation and the distribution of overpressured zone in the North Sumatra Basin. The overpressure in this research area is caused by non-loading mechanism with the transformation of smectite into illite. The top of overpressure generally follows stratigraphic layer and sometimes it crosses the stratigraphic layer.
